Given-α+β=3/2αβ =-5We know that quadrant equation is of the form:x²-(α+β)x+(αβ) =0x²-3x/2-5=0(2x²-3x-10)/2=02x²-3x-10=0
Sum (s) = 3/2 and Product (p) = -5. Polynomial p(x) = k (x^2 – sx + p) = k (x^2 – 3/2x – 5) = k (2x^2 – 3x – 10)//
